![]() |
Browse - но с компьютера пользователя.
Требуется загрузить картинку с компьютера пользователя. Этот код воспринимает только файлы из той же директории localhost'a, где находится swf. Как быть?
Код:
import flash.display.*; |
nork, пожалуйста оформите код тегами [code][/code].
|
В связи с этим хотелось бы еще спросить: можно ли проследить полный путь к файлу, загружаемому пользователем? И если да, то какими средствами?
Увы, увы, эта тема уже поднималась. http://board.flashkit.com/board/show....php?p=3363002 http://flasher.ru/forum/showthread.php?t=87782 ............... Вопросы безопасности в который раз встают на пути вопросов творчества. |
Ни одно браузерное приложение не имеет права работать с локальными данными пользователя.
|
Но, тем не менее, предоставить право пользователю загружать файлы со своего компьютера мы можем(<input type="file">), и можем также прописать javascript, который сообщит флэш-приложению абсолютный путь. Вопрос в том, как средствами самого флэша реализовать возможность загружать файл из любого места на диске, кроме корневой директории.
|
Это невозможно, ещё раз повторяю.
|
| Часовой пояс GMT +4, время: 06:59. |
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.